第2卷第5期 智能系统学报 Vol.2 Na 5 2007年10月 CAAI Transactions on Intelligent Systems 0ct.2007 基于群体智能框架理念的遗传算法总体模式描述 康琦,汪镭,刘小莉,吴启迪 (同济大学电子与信息工程学院,上海200092) 摘要:在各类群体智能算法中,不同的智能体群往往具有不同的外在表现形式,但他们所表现出来的智能计算模 式具有相对的统一性.为了验证这一理念并从宏观的视角来研究群体智能理论,对群体智能中各类智能计算模式进 行总结提炼,提出了群体智能计算的一种内在统一的总体框架模型,并以遗传算法为例加以具体论述与验证,给出 了基于群体智能框架理念的遗传算法总体模式描述 关键词:群体智能;框架描述;总体模式;遗传算法 中图分类号:TP18文献标识码:A文章编号:1673-4785(2007)050042-06 General mode description genetic algorithms based on a frame work of swarm intelligence KANG Qi,WANGLei,LIU Xiao-li,WU Qi-di (College of Electronics and Information Engineering,Tongji University,Shanghai 200092,China) Abstract:Different computational modes of agents take on relatively uniform characteristics in different kinds of swarm intelligence algorithms,though they usually have different extrinsic forms.To verify this idea and make further systematic study of swarm intelligence from a more macroscopic angle,various kinds of intelligent computational modes in the field of swarm intelligence were identified and are summarized in this paper.Based on this work,a uniform framework describing swarm intelligence is proposed,dis- cussed,and then shown to be valid using a genetic algorithm.Finally,a general description of genetic al- gorithms is presented based on the idea of a framework of swarm intelligence. Key words:swarm intelligence;framework description;general mode;genetic algorithm 在人工智能研究领域随着对各类智能计算模 种模拟自然界遗传机制和生物进化的并行随机优化 式研究的深入进行,群体智能这个主题理念及相关 方法,也可以看作群体智能的一种典型实现模式.本 研究领域开始引起了人们的注意.群体智能是一 文首先提出一种群体智能内在的统一框架模型,然 种在自然界生物群体所表现出的智能现象启发下提 后在此基础上,针对遗传算法给出其群体智能框架 出的人工智能模式,是对简单生物群体的智能涌现 模式,并给出遗传算法的形式化模型。 现象的具体模式研究2引.该种智能模式需要以相 当数目的智能个体来实现对某类问题的求解功能. 1 群体智能的统一框架理念 群体智能自提出以来,由于其在解决复杂的组合优 一般而言,群体智能以自然界中生物系统行为 化类问题方面所具有的优越性能,在诸如优化问题 为参照基础,研究其中所蕴含的丰富的信息处理机 求解、机器人领域、电力系统领域、网络及通讯领域、 制,在所需求解问题特征的相关目标导引下,提取相 计算机领域、半导体制造领域和工程设计领域等取 应的计算模型,设计相应的智能算法,通过相关的信 得了较为成功的应用4.遗传算法是由美国 息感知积累、知识方法提升、任务调度实施、定点信 Michigan大学的John Holland教授首先提出的一 息交换等模块的协同工作,得到智能化的信息处理 收稿日期:200612-05. 效果,并在各相关领域加以应用 基金项目:国家重点基础研究发展计划资助项目(2002CB312202);因 在群体智能中,信息处理模式均是模拟自然界 家自然科学基金资助项目(70531020,50408034):国家发 改委CNGI计划资助项目(CNG041子5A-2) 相关生物组织和生物系统智能特征的.这是进化计 1994-2009 China Academic Journal Electronic Publishing House.All rights reserved http://www.cnki.net第 2 卷第 5 期 智 能 系 统 学 报 Vol. 2 №. 5 2007 年 10 月 CAAI Transactions on Intelligent Systems Oct. 2007 基于群体智能框架理念的遗传算法总体模式描述 康 琦 ,汪 镭 ,刘小莉 ,吴启迪 (同济大学 电子与信息工程学院 ,上海 200092) 摘 要 :在各类群体智能算法中 ,不同的智能体群往往具有不同的外在表现形式 ,但他们所表现出来的智能计算模 式具有相对的统一性. 为了验证这一理念并从宏观的视角来研究群体智能理论 ,对群体智能中各类智能计算模式进 行总结提炼 ,提出了群体智能计算的一种内在统一的总体框架模型 ,并以遗传算法为例加以具体论述与验证 ,给出 了基于群体智能框架理念的遗传算法总体模式描述. 关键词 :群体智能 ;框架描述 ;总体模式 ;遗传算法 中图分类号 : TP18 文献标识码 :A 文章编号 :167324785 (2007) 0520042206 General mode description genetic algorithms based on a framework of swarm intelligence KAN G Qi ,WAN G Lei , L IU Xiao2li , WU Qi2di (College of Electronics and Information Engineering , Tongji University , Shanghai 200092 , China) Abstract :Different comp utational modes of agents take on relatively uniform characteristics in different kinds of swarm intelligence algorit hms , though t hey usually have different extrinsic forms. To verify this idea and make f urt her systematic st udy of swarm intelligence from a more macroscopic angle , various kinds of intelligent comp utational modes in t he field of swarm intelligence were identified and are summarized in t his paper. Based on t his work , a uniform framework describing swarm intelligence is proposed , dis2 cussed , and t hen shown to be valid using a genetic algorit hm. Finally , a general description of genetic al2 gorithms is p resented based on t he idea of a framework of swarm intelligence . Keywords :swarm intelligence ; framework description ; general mode ; genetic algorit hm 收稿日期 :2006212205. 基金项目 :国家重点基础研究发展计划资助项目(2002CB312202) ;国 家自然科学基金资助项目 (70531020 ,50408034) ;国家发 改委 CN GI 计划资助项目(CN GI20421525A22) . 在人工智能研究领域 ,随着对各类智能计算模 式研究的深入进行 ,群体智能这个主题理念及相关 研究领域开始引起了人们的注意[1 ] . 群体智能是一 种在自然界生物群体所表现出的智能现象启发下提 出的人工智能模式 ,是对简单生物群体的智能涌现 现象的具体模式研究[ 2 - 3 ] . 该种智能模式需要以相 当数目的智能个体来实现对某类问题的求解功能. 群体智能自提出以来 ,由于其在解决复杂的组合优 化类问题方面所具有的优越性能 ,在诸如优化问题 求解、机器人领域、电力系统领域、网络及通讯领域、 计算机领域、半导体制造领域和工程设计领域等取 得了较 为 成 功 的 应 用[4 - 5 ] . 遗 传 算 法 是 由 美 国 Michigan 大学的 John Holland 教授首先提出的一 种模拟自然界遗传机制和生物进化的并行随机优化 方法 ,也可以看作群体智能的一种典型实现模式. 本 文首先提出一种群体智能内在的统一框架模型 ,然 后在此基础上 ,针对遗传算法给出其群体智能框架 模式 ,并给出遗传算法的形式化模型. 1 群体智能的统一框架理念 一般而言 ,群体智能以自然界中生物系统行为 为参照基础 ,研究其中所蕴含的丰富的信息处理机 制 ,在所需求解问题特征的相关目标导引下 ,提取相 应的计算模型 ,设计相应的智能算法 ,通过相关的信 息感知积累、知识方法提升、任务调度实施、定点信 息交换等模块的协同工作 ,得到智能化的信息处理 效果 ,并在各相关领域加以应用. 在群体智能中 ,信息处理模式均是模拟自然界 相关生物组织和生物系统智能特征的. 这是进化计 © 1994-2009 China Academic Journal Electronic Publishing House. All rights reserved. http://www.cnki.net